How should a Christian react when they find out their partner has been cheating?
Discovering a partner's infidelity is a devastating betrayal, and a Christian's initial reaction should be to lean on God for emotional strength and guidance (Psalm 34:18), not immediate retaliation. The biblical response requires a process that involves lament, decisive action (Matthew 18:15-17), and a reliance on the Gospel's power to either forgive or justly separate. While the option for divorce is biblically permitted in cases of sexual immorality (Matthew 19:9), the primary call is to seek holiness, truth, and genuine repentance for the preservation of the soul and the family.
